    Hello,

    I dont need to use the profiler for R3E, but have already installed correctly the latest Logitech drivers for my G25 wheel on W10 64bits and each time I launch R3E it load automaticaly the Logitech Profiler even if it is completely closed before the R3E launch. Right now I press ALT+TAB to minimize R3E in the windows task bar and close the profiler manualy then I call again R3E. This situation is annoying and would like to know how to stop R3E from loading each time the soft Profiler.
    Any idea how to do ?

    Yes Fairman you are right the Profiler soft is interfering with the FFB wheel and we (Logitech wheels owners) don't need the Profiler soft to play R3E.
    When I look only at the windows controller wheel with the Logitech drivers installed there I disable the entire FFB effects (unticking the cases) and now loading the profiler soft and looking at the global settings for the wheel, I constate the FFB effects are always enabled. I was thinking the global settings FFB in the Profiler was based to the windows controller wheel settings, but in reality that's not the same. The Profiler soft enable always the FFB. I don't need the Logitech's drivers FFB only the FFB from the game settings are enough. A sort of mixing FFB between the Logitech Profiler soft and FFB settings from the game interfer badly
